29
Programmēšana s vieta skolā Aija Lūse

Programmēšanas vieta skolā

  • Upload
    asha

  • View
    53

  • Download
    0

Embed Size (px)

DESCRIPTION

Programmēšanas vieta skolā. Aija Lūse. 1999. 2 . Kāpēc skolās interese par programm ēšanu pēdējo 10 - 15 gadu laikā ir kritusies? - PowerPoint PPT Presentation

Citation preview

Page 1: Programmēšanas vieta skolā

Programmēšanas vieta skolāAija Lūse

Page 2: Programmēšanas vieta skolā

199919992. Kāpēc skolās interese par programmēšanu pēdējo 10 - 15 gadu laikā ir kritusies?4. Parādījušās jaunas programmēšanas valodas ar grafiskajiem elementiem, kurās tekstam ir maznozīmīga loma. Vai tas būtiski maina programmēšanas pasniegšanu?5. Dažas no jaunajām valodām ir specializējušās robotu programmēšanā. Vai tas ir labi un neierobežo to iespējas?

6. Vai programmēšana ir par grūtu? Skolēniem? Skolotājiem?

Page 3: Programmēšanas vieta skolā

PProgrammrogrammēšanas labās īpašībasēšanas labās īpašības

• Procedurāla domāšana• Problēmu risināšanas pieredze, pamēģinot un

kļūdoties• Radošums• Domāšana par domāšanu• Spēļu programmēšana• Valodas programmēšana • Simulācijas• Matemātikas un dabaszinātņu pielietojums• Pamatzināšanas par datoriem• Loģiskā domāšana

Page 4: Programmēšanas vieta skolā

20132013 – – ««EEiiropropaa nevarnevar aatļauties pazaudēt tļauties pazaudēt

laivu»laivu»•

digital literacy informatics

• Digital literacy – pamatiemaņu kopums• informatics - zinātne1.Rekomendācija - digital literacy līdz 12 gadiem 2.Rekomendācija - visiem skolēniem jāapgūst informātika 3.Rekomendācija - jāuzsāk plaša skolotāju apmācības

programma. Lai īsā laikā to paveiktu, katram skolotājam jāpiesaista eksperts no akadēmiskās vides vai industrijas

4.Rekomendācija - informātikas kursa saturs jāpārskata

Page 5: Programmēšanas vieta skolā

Digital literacyDigital literacy - - pamatiemaņaspamatiemaņas

• spēj rakstīt ar datoru, izveidot un rediģēt dokumentus, prezentācijas and zīmējumus. • izprot informācijas mērvienības (ietilpība un ātrums). • zina teksta, audio, video un attēlu datņu pamatīpašibas • zina kā meklēt, kopēt un saglabāt informāciju kā datni • zina kā kopēt, pārsaukt, dzēst un sistematizēt datnes, veidojot mapes un dublējumkopijas• spēj komunicēt, izmantojot e-pastu, sociālos tīklus un forumus • spēj izvēlēties un atrast šīm vajadzībām piemērotākos rīkus

Page 6: Programmēšanas vieta skolā

Digital literacyDigital literacy – ētikas – ētikas un drošības aspektiun drošības aspekti

• zina ētiskas uzvedības principus internetā • spēj atšķirt reālo no virtuālā • zina par apdraudējumiem internetā • spēj kritiski novērtēt internetā pieejamo informāciju• zina, kas ir plaģiātisms un kā apieties ar internetā atrastu informāciju, lai netiktu pārkāptas autortiesības• zina par kuru datu privātumu būtu jārūpējas un spēj izvēlēties rīkus, lai to nodrošinātu

Page 7: Programmēšanas vieta skolā

InformInformātika – ātika – problproblēēmmu risināšanau risināšana • spēj veidot abstrakciju – modeļus, simulācijas • spēj strukturēt un analizēt datus.• spēj sastādīt algoritmu, izmantojot pamatdarbības (zarošanās, atkārtošana utml.).• spēj analizēt un realizēt dažādus iespējamos algoritmus ar mērķi sasniegt pēc iespējas efektīvāku gan datora, gan cilvēcisko resursu izmantojumu• spēj formulēt problēmu kā ar datora palīdzību risināmu uzdevumu • spēj vispārināt problēmu risināšanas metodes , lai pielietotu tās plašam problēmu lokam

Page 8: Programmēšanas vieta skolā

InformInformāātitika – ka – inteleintelekktutuālās spējasālās spējas

• pieredze darboties ar sarežģītām sistēmām • neatlaidība cīnīties ar grūtām problēmām • spēja darboties ar līdz galam neatrisināmām problēmām • spēja rēķināties gan ar cilvēciskajiem, gan tehniskajiem aspektiem (lietotāja vajadzības, saskarne, lietotāja apmācība un psiholoģija..) • spēja komunicēt un sadarboties ar citiem lai sasniegtu mērķi

Page 9: Programmēšanas vieta skolā

InformInformātikas loma ātikas loma mācību procesāmācību procesā

• Informātika attīsta radošumu – vienu un to pašu problēmu var risināt dažādos veidos• Informātika ir konstruktīva - algoritmu un dizainu konstruēšana• Informātika palīdz nebaidīties no sarežģītā – spēja risināt informātikas problēmas palīdz risināt sarežģītas problēmas citās jomās (piemēram, sadalot tās mazākos uzdevumos). • Informātika paaugstina noteiktību un precizitāti, jo programmas veiksmīga uzrakstīšana prasa rūpīgi pārdomāt katru sīkumu.

Page 10: Programmēšanas vieta skolā

Kas notiek Eiropā?Kas notiek Eiropā?• Igaunijā – «Tīģera lēciens» jeb programmēšana

no 1.klases• Anglijā plāno kardinālas izmaiņas mācību plānos

5 līdz 14 gadus veciem bērniem• Somijā plāno ieviest programmēšanu sākumskolā• Dānijā (kopā ar Lietuvu) pētījums par

programmēšanas mācīšanu skolā

Page 11: Programmēšanas vieta skolā

Prog eTi igerProg eTi iger• ele men tary schools - sug gests teach ing through

pro gram ming lan guages KODU Game Lab and MSW Logo

• mid dle school - choos ing between either pro gram ming with LEGO robots or web pro gram ming.

• secondary school - pro gramming in NXT-G and NXC lan guages for the robots, a less expe ri enced stu dent could take on web design and pro gram ming instead.

• high school - creating websites and web design, as well as creating web applications. These are an addition to the optional courses from the national curriculum entitled 'Programming and the basics of application development'.

Page 12: Programmēšanas vieta skolā

ECDL – mistake?ECDL – mistake?We made the mistake of thinking that learning about computing is like learning to drive a car, and since a knowledge of internal combustion technology is not essential for becoming a proficient driver, it followed that an understanding of how computers work was not important for our children. The crowning apotheosis of this category mistake is a much-vaunted "qualification" called the European Computer Driving Licence.

Page 13: Programmēšanas vieta skolā

UK - tUK - the new national he new national curriculumcurriculum

• In the first year of school - to read and write numbers up to 100, count in multiples of ones, twos, fives and tens and learn a series of simple sums using addition and subtraction off by heart.

• Children will also be introduced to basic fractions such as ½ and ¼ at the age of 5

• In computing, pupils will be taught how to code and solve practical computer problems at 11 rather than using work processing packages;

• In design and technology classes, children will work with hi-tech devices such as 3D printers, laser cutters, robots and microprocessors.

Page 14: Programmēšanas vieta skolā

England England - - computer programming computer programming

in primary and secondary schoolsin primary and secondary schools

• stage 1 - students will be expected to create and debug simple programs as well as ‘use technology safely and respectfully’. They will also be taught to understand what algorithms are, how they are implemented as programs on digital devices, and that programs execute by following precise and unambiguous instructions.

• stage 2 - pupils will be taught how to design and write programs that accomplish specific goals, including controlling or simulating physical systems. They will also learn how to understand computer networks and use logical reasoning to detect and correct errors in algorithms.

• stage 3 - students will be taught about Boolean logic, given an understanding of algorithms that reflect computational thinking and be taught about the different hardware and software components that make up computer systems and how they communicate with one another and other systems.

Page 15: Programmēšanas vieta skolā

Kā mācīt?Kā mācīt?• Knowing how to program Being able to teach

programming

Page 16: Programmēšanas vieta skolā

ProgrammProgrammēšanaēšana IRIR grūtagrūta

Kas vajadzīgs, lai sekmīgi apgūtu programmēšanu?•Pareiza orientācija – saprast ieguvumus•Zināšanas par tās ierīces īpašībām, kuru jāmācās vadīt (programmēt)•Zināšanas par to, kā programma vada ierīci•Dažādu formālu valodu sintakse un semantika•Strukturēšana jeb lielā uzdevuma sadalīšana mazākos•Pragmatisms – saplānot, izveidot un notestēt programmu ar pieejamajiem rīkiem Ja tā visa nav, tad:•Skolēni komunicē ar datoru tā, it kā tas būtu cilvēks -dusmojas, apvainojas, uzskata ka dators var vairāk, bet negrib un nedara to, ko ES gribu

Page 17: Programmēšanas vieta skolā

SSkolēnu problēmaskolēnu problēmas1)orientācija - nesaprot iespējamos ieguvumus mācoties programmēšanu2)zināšanu trūkums par tās ierīces īpašībām, kuru jāmācās vadīt (programmēt) un vadības mehānismu3)nepietiekamas zināšanas par valodas sintaksi un semantiku4) grūtības strukturēt uzdevumu, ieraudzīt iespēju izmantot gatavu konstrukciju (piem. ciklu) 5) grūti pieņemt, ka jāiztiek ar tiem rīkiem, kas ir viņu rīcībā

Page 18: Programmēšanas vieta skolā

Kas mācīs?Kas mācīs?Informātikas skolotājiem trūkst pārliecības par savām spējāmsociālo pētījumu kompānijas «MyKindaCrowd» dati - 54% Anglijas informātikas skolotāju uzskata, ka skolēni IT jomā zina vairāk par skolotājiem

Page 19: Programmēšanas vieta skolā

Latvijas vieta Eiropā?

• Labā ziņa:

•mēs esam Eiropā – esam tikpat slinki, un mums ir visas viņu problēmas

•Vai mums ir nākotnes vīzija?

Page 20: Programmēšanas vieta skolā

Pieticīgā vīzija – izmaiņas informātikas saturā

• 5. un 6. klasē darbs ar datnēm un tīklu, attēlu, teksta un prezentāciju apstrāde, drošības un ētikas jautājumi

• 7. klasē – web lapu veidošanas pamati un/vai programmēšanas pamati (JavaScript?)

• Vidusskolā: pasta sapludināšana, aprēķini izklājlapās, interaktīvas web lapas, tajā skaitā ar datu bāzēm

Page 21: Programmēšanas vieta skolā

Pieticīgā vīzija – programmēšana

• Kā fakultatīvs pieejama katrā skolā

• Dabaszinātņu un matemātikas klasēm obligāta

• Vai mums vajag jaunu standartu?

Page 22: Programmēšanas vieta skolā

Fantastiskā vīzija..

• Informātika kā domāšanas, radošuma un tehnoloģiju mācība no 1. līdz 12.klasei

• Spēlēšanās, zīmēšana, muzicēšana, konstruktori, roboti

• klases avīze, weblapa, radiostacija, TV, veikals, dizaina studija, konstruktoru birojs

Page 23: Programmēšanas vieta skolā

Kas mums jau ir?

Skola Matemātikas stundu skaits 7.klasē (nedēļā )

RV1ģ 9

R6vsk 6

J4vsk 6 (3x2)

Patnis 7

RTvsk 7

RAģ 6 (3grupās)

R18vmvsk 5 (no 29)

Matemātika, informātika, programmēšana

StartIT, mentori, web resursi

Page 24: Programmēšanas vieta skolā

Varbūt vajag paskatīties no cita skatu punkta..

Page 25: Programmēšanas vieta skolā

Vai tikai sieviešu problēma?

Krāpnieka sindroms (Impostor Syndrome) -

Sajusties kā blēdim, kas ieņēmis amatu, kuram nav pietiekami kompetents, un tūlīt tiks atmaskots un ar kaunu

padzīts

Page 26: Programmēšanas vieta skolā

Mācības – pa dzimumiem

Uzlabo meiteņu sniegumu, pasliktina puišu

Diāna Jaunžeikare:

•Smith College http://www.smith.edu

•Software Engineer at Google

Page 27: Programmēšanas vieta skolā

Divas liecības?

1. Dzīvesprieks

2. Elastīgums

3. Pašdisciplīna

4. Godīgums

5. Drosme

6. Laipnība

7. Pateicīgums

Page 28: Programmēšanas vieta skolā

Izglītības nākotne? («Rīgas Laiks»,2014/02 )

• Pa pasauli pārvietojas 6 miljoni studentu• ASV eksperti – «jēdzīgas 50 no 4000 augstskolām»• MOOC - Massive Open Online Courses http://www.mooc-list.com – Krievijā reģistrējušies 600000• MIT plāns – miljons studentu (klātienē 13-14 tūkstoši)• Bērklija+MIT+Stanforda+Hārvarda – plāno miljards

studentu• JA UNIVERSITĀTE NAV SPĒJĪGA IZVEIDOT TĀDU

SISTĒMU, KAS APMĀCA ĀTRĀK NEKĀ DZĪVE, TAD TAI NAV NĀKOTNES!

Page 29: Programmēšanas vieta skolā

Izmantotie resursi

• Informatics education: Europe cannot afford to miss the boat. Report of the joint Informatics Europe & ACM Europe Working Group on Informatics Education April 2013

• http://www.innovatsioonikeskus.ee/en/programming-schools-and-hobby-clubs• The telegraph By Peter Dominiczak, Political Correspondent

9:07AM BST 08 Jul 2013• http://www.independent.co.uk/life-style/gadgets-and-tech/news/educators-call-

for-reform-in-how-programming-is-taught-in-schools-8934893.html• http://mashable.com/2013/11/16/finland-tech-education-schools/• alexandria.tue.nl/extra2/724491.pdf• www.loria.fr/.../blog/.../120326-PCK-of-programming.pdf• http://adainitiative.org/2013/08/is-impostor-syndrome-keeping-women-out-of-

open-technology-and-culture/• Educational Technology & Society 2(4) 1999 ISSN 1436-4522 6

7KHUROHRIFRPSXWHUSURJUDPPLQJLQHGXFDWLRQ• «Rīgas Laiks»,2014/02